2. Introduction
The concept of registration of certain
human transaction by state is evolved.
To ensure that this process of
registration will be carried in a proper
way, the need for legislative enactment
was felt. Accordingly way back in 1908
registration act was enacted.
3. Why needs registration
act?
•To particular document which may
afterwards be of legal importance.
• To give information to people
regarding legal right and obligation
arising or affecting a particular
property.
•To ensure proper preservation and
record of document.
•To prevent fraud.
